FoxPro/Visual FoxPro - guardar en tabla

 
Vista:

guardar en tabla

Publicado por miriam (67 intervenciones) el 31/07/2007 20:53:01
hola, alguien tendra conocimiento de como guardar un dato en una tabla, lo que pasa es q estoy trabajando en un formulario y en ese salen datos que tengo que ir guardando en dos tablas.
mis tablas son
PAGOS
ALUMNOS

en donde en Alumnos guardo en dato
Select ALUMNOS
ALUMNOS.importe=Importe1

Slect PAGOS
PAGOS.Linea=linea1

PEro al momento de llegar a la linea PAGOS.Linea=linea1 me manda en error "No se encuentra el objeto PAGOS"

que tengo que modificar para que me guarde los datos en las tablas.

Gracias
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:guardar en tabla

Publicado por JorgeE (423 intervenciones) el 31/07/2007 21:04:40
Como abres tus tables?, puedes usar la instruccion INSERT INTO ó UPDATE para agregar tus datos en las tablas correspondientes

INSERT INTO pagos (linea) values (linea1) ó UPDATE pagos SET linea=linea1 WHERE codigoalumno=idalumno

o bien
Select Pagos

REPLACE linea WITH linea1
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
sin imagen de perfil

RE:guardar en tabla

Publicado por neo (1604 intervenciones) el 31/07/2007 21:18:03
Revisa bien esta linea

Slect PAGOS
PAGOS.Linea=linea1

debe ser:

Select PAGOS
PAGOS.Linea=linea1

El error se debe a que no encuentra la tabla, ya sea po estar mal escrito o por no declararlo.

Suerte►
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:guardar en tabla

Publicado por miriam (67 intervenciones) el 31/07/2007 21:38:09
Asilo tengo:

select pagos
pagos.importe2=impor2

Pero me envia ese mensaje de que no se encuetra el objeto PAGOS.

Gracias
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:guardar en tabla

Publicado por JorgeE (423 intervenciones) el 31/07/2007 21:42:23
no esta abierta la tabla por lo tanto no genera el objeto especificado como PAGOS
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:guardar en tabla

Publicado por miriam (67 intervenciones) el 31/07/2007 22:07:45
como la puedo abrir??
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:guardar en tabla

Publicado por JorgeE (423 intervenciones) el 31/07/2007 22:45:07
depende de si vinculaste o no en el entorno de datos de tu formulario a las tablas, si no fue asi, entonces tienes que hacer esto:

USE PAGOS, antes de hacer el SELECT a tus tablas

si por el contrario las vinculas al entorno de datos,este mismo se encarga de abrir y cerrar tablas. en este caso el uso del SELECT PAGOS esta correcto de la forma que lo usas.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
sin imagen de perfil

RE:guardar en tabla

Publicado por neo (1604 intervenciones) el 01/08/2007 15:10:41
Para el Entorno de Datos:

Click Derecho en el DataEnvironment:
Selecciona Agregar y pulsa en la tabla pagos

Ya con eso solo basta con un "Select Pagos"

Otra Forma, desde el Load del Formulario:

Open Database Mi_Base_de_Datos.dbc

Select 1
Use Pagos.dbf

Select 2
Use Mi_otra Tabla.dbf

Ya con eso solo basta con un: "Select 1" para la primera tabla y "Select 2" para la segunda tabla.

Suerte►

Nota:
Cualquier cosa solo postea
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:guardar en tabla

Publicado por miriam (67 intervenciones) el 01/08/2007 16:11:21
Hola, gracias por responder, si ya tengo en el entorno de datos las tablas que uso en ese formulario pero me sigue apareciendo el mensaje de que el objeto no se encuentra, este es mi codigo:

select pagos
pagos.importe2=impor2

en cuanto llega al a segunda linea me aparece ese error.

Gracias
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
sin imagen de perfil

RE:guardar en tabla

Publicado por neo (1604 intervenciones) el 01/08/2007 17:45:15
Me puedes envíar a mi email un mensaje para darme una idea.

Saludos..

Note;
Ya intentaste al reves:

Import2=pagos.importe2

suerte
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
sin imagen de perfil

RE:guardar en tabla

Publicado por neo (1604 intervenciones) el 01/08/2007 17:49:26
Quise decir una imagen o un ejemplo para solucionar ya tu problema...

Suerte►
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:guardar en tabla

Publicado por miriam (67 intervenciones) el 01/08/2007 17:56:11
cual es tu correo??
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
sin imagen de perfil

RE:guardar en tabla

Publicado por Ernesto Hernandez (4623 intervenciones) el 01/08/2007 22:29:18
PRUEBA abriendo las tablas en el entorno de datos de la forma

suerte
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ar